Last year's Samsung Galaxy Watch 6 drops below the $200 mark for the first time in a 44mm size

Instead of being canceled entirely after the sequel was announced a few months ago, the sequel was released in 2023 Galaxy Watch 6 continues to receive increasingly steep discounts at major US retailers like Amazon and Walmart, so from a price point of view it appears to be a better choice than the hot new Galaxy Watch 7 for many Android users.

The latest offering may be the best yet, at least for potential buyers with larger-than-average wrists. Yes, the huge 44mm Samsung Galaxy Watch 6 without a standalone cellular connection is the variant currently available on Amazon at the biggest discount in a single graphite color and costs incredibly less than its little brother.
It goes without saying that this is a much cheaper device than the one mentioned above Galaxy Watch 7which itself is sold at special prices. The two Wear OS-based smart timepieces aren't nearly as different as you might expect, sharing many of the same features and capabilities, particularly in the area of ​​health and fitness tracking.

Granted, the newer model has a newer and surprisingly faster processor as well as twice as much 16GB storage as its predecessor, but the predecessor still runs pretty smoothly (especially for the newly reduced price) and essentially offers an unrivaled value Performance ratio.
